    The most popular episode of 2025 was about the psychology of cats 😻

    Dr Claude Béata, animal behaviouralist and author of The Interpretation of Cats, emphasises cats dual role as both predator and prey and how this distinction can help us understand these most wonderful creatures.

    • Do habits really take 66 days to form?
    • Should you rely on willpower?
    • How does a psychologist approach overcoming their own bad habits and starting good ones?

    Professor Ben Gardner leads me through the intricate world of habits, exploring their definitions, the distinction between habits and routines, and the psychological mechanisms behind habitual behaviour.
